#f3331c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f3331c is composed of 95.3% red, 20%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79% magenta, 88.5%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 6.4 degrees, a saturation of 90% and a lightness of 53.1%. #f3331c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6638 with #e70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#f3331c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f3331c has RGB values of R:243, G:51,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.88,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15938332.

Hex triplet f3331c #f3331c
RGB Decimal 243, 51, 28 rgb(243,51,28)
RGB Percent 95.3, 20, 11 rgb(95.3%,20%,11%)
CMYK 0, 79, 88, 5
HSL 6.4°, 90, 53.1 hsl(6.4,90%,53.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 6.4°, 88.5, 95.3
Web Safe ff3333 #ff3333
CIE-LAB 53.504, 69.907, 57.916
XYZ 38.358, 21.511, 3.231
xyY 0.608, 0.341, 21.511
CIE-LCH 53.504, 90.781, 39.641
CIE-LUV 53.504, 150.265, 37.487
Hunter-Lab 46.38, 66.46, 28.336
Binary 11110011, 00110011, 00011100

Shades and Tints of #f3331c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0201 is the darkest color, while #fffcfc is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#f3331c is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#6a6a6a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#855f5a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#958638 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#a87f00 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#f43b3b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#b7682e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#c3630a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#f33830 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
